From f126ea00d5a6804142dbcd0234deae103286eeec Mon Sep 17 00:00:00 2001 From: menxipeng Date: Mon, 1 Sep 2025 20:24:53 +0800 Subject: [PATCH] =?UTF-8?q?=E6=8E=A8=E8=8D=90=E9=9F=B3=E4=B9=90=E5=A2=9E?= =?UTF-8?q?=E5=8A=A0reId?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/com/ruoyi/web/controller/client/MusicController.java | 4 +++- .../java/com/ruoyi/common/core/domain/entity/MusicInfo.java | 2 ++ .../src/main/resources/mapper/system/MusicInfoMapper.xml | 3 ++- 3 files changed, 7 insertions(+), 2 deletions(-) diff --git a/ruoyi-admin/src/main/java/com/ruoyi/web/controller/client/MusicController.java b/ruoyi-admin/src/main/java/com/ruoyi/web/controller/client/MusicController.java index 28f4b8d..2db72c9 100644 --- a/ruoyi-admin/src/main/java/com/ruoyi/web/controller/client/MusicController.java +++ b/ruoyi-admin/src/main/java/com/ruoyi/web/controller/client/MusicController.java @@ -155,7 +155,9 @@ public class MusicController extends BaseController { @RequestParam(required = false) String currentMusicId){ Long userId = SecurityUtils.getUserId(); String nextMusicId = musicService.getNextMusicId(userId, playMode, playlistType, categoryId, collectId, reId,currentMusicId); - return AjaxResult.success("请求成功",nextMusicId); + Map result = new HashMap<>(); + result.put("musicId",nextMusicId); + return AjaxResult.success("请求成功",result); } diff --git a/ruoyi-common/src/main/java/com/ruoyi/common/core/domain/entity/MusicInfo.java b/ruoyi-common/src/main/java/com/ruoyi/common/core/domain/entity/MusicInfo.java index 01aa2d8..ff4e354 100644 --- a/ruoyi-common/src/main/java/com/ruoyi/common/core/domain/entity/MusicInfo.java +++ b/ruoyi-common/src/main/java/com/ruoyi/common/core/domain/entity/MusicInfo.java @@ -76,4 +76,6 @@ public class MusicInfo extends BaseEntity private String fileType; + private String recommendId; + } diff --git a/ruoyi-system/src/main/resources/mapper/system/MusicInfoMapper.xml b/ruoyi-system/src/main/resources/mapper/system/MusicInfoMapper.xml index 4eaa02d..0744e1a 100644 --- a/ruoyi-system/src/main/resources/mapper/system/MusicInfoMapper.xml +++ b/ruoyi-system/src/main/resources/mapper/system/MusicInfoMapper.xml @@ -21,6 +21,7 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N" + @@ -139,7 +140,7 @@ PUBLIC "-//mybatis.org//DTD Mapper 3.0//EN"